一键备份数据库全表指南
数据库所有表备份

首页 2025-03-30 15:02:13



数据库所有表备份:确保数据安全与业务连续性的基石 在当今信息化高速发展的时代,数据已成为企业最宝贵的资产之一

    无论是金融、医疗、教育还是电商等行业,数据都扮演着至关重要的角色

    它不仅记录着企业的运营状况、客户信息,还蕴含着市场趋势、用户行为等宝贵信息

    然而,随着数据的不断增长和业务对数据的依赖程度日益加深,数据安全问题也日益凸显

    其中,数据库所有表备份作为数据安全策略的核心环节,其重要性不容忽视

    本文将深入探讨数据库所有表备份的必要性、实施策略、最佳实践以及面临的挑战与解决方案,旨在为企业构建一套高效、可靠的数据备份体系提供有力支持

     一、数据库所有表备份的必要性 1.数据丢失风险防控 硬件故障、自然灾害、人为误操作等因素都可能导致数据丢失

    一旦核心数据丢失,企业可能面临巨大的经济损失、信誉损害甚至法律纠纷

    数据库所有表备份能够确保在任何情况下,企业都能迅速恢复数据,将损失降到最低

     2.业务连续性保障 在高度竞争的市场环境中,业务中断意味着失去客户、市场份额和收入

    通过定期备份数据库所有表,企业可以在遭遇系统故障时快速切换至备份数据,确保业务不中断,提升客户满意度和忠诚度

     3.合规性与审计需求 许多行业受到严格的监管要求,需要保留一定时间内的交易记录、客户信息等数据以供审计

    数据库所有表备份不仅满足合规性要求,还能在必要时提供准确、完整的数据支持审计过程

     二、实施数据库所有表备份的策略 1.制定备份计划 根据数据的重要性、变化频率和业务需求,制定合理的备份计划

    这包括确定备份的时间点(如全量备份的频率、增量备份或差异备份的间隔)、备份数据的存储位置(本地、云端或异地)、以及备份数据的保留期限

     2.选择合适的备份工具 市场上有众多数据库备份工具可供选择,如MySQL的mysqldump、PostgreSQL的pg_dump、以及针对大型数据库的专用备份软件(如Oracle的RMAN)

    选择时需考虑工具的兼容性、性能、易用性以及是否支持自动化调度和监控

     3.实施自动化备份 手动备份不仅效率低下,还容易出错

    通过配置备份任务的自动化脚本或利用备份软件的调度功能,可以实现备份任务的定时执行、自动验证备份完整性以及通知机制,大大减轻运维负担

     4.加密与压缩 为了增强备份数据的安全性,应对备份数据进行加密处理,防止数据在传输和存储过程中被非法访问

    同时,采用压缩技术可以减少备份数据的存储空间需求,降低存储成本

     三、数据库所有表备份的最佳实践 1.异地备份 将备份数据存放在与主数据中心物理隔离的地点,可以有效抵御区域性灾难(如地震、洪水)对数据的影响

    结合云存储服务,可以进一步提升备份数据的可用性和恢复速度

     2.定期测试恢复流程 备份的目的在于恢复

    因此,定期(至少每年一次)进行恢复演练,验证备份数据的可用性和恢复流程的可行性,是确保备份有效性的关键步骤

     3.文档化与培训 建立完善的备份与恢复文档,包括备份策略、操作步骤、常见问题及解决方案等,便于新员工快速上手和应对紧急情况

    同时,定期对相关人员进行培训,提升团队的数据安全意识

     4.监控与报警 实施备份任务的监控,实时跟踪备份进度、成功率以及存储空间使用情况

    一旦检测到异常,立即触发报警机制,确保问题得到及时处理

     四、面临的挑战与解决方案 1.数据量激增带来的备份压力 随着业务的发展,数据库数据量快速增长,给备份任务带来巨大压力

    解决方案包括采用分布式备份架构、利用云存储的弹性扩展能力、以及实施数据分级备份策略,优先备份关键数据

     2.备份窗口有限 在生产环境中,备份窗口往往非常有限,需要在不影响业务运行的前提下完成备份

    这要求优化备份策略,如采用增量备份减少备份数据量、利用业务低峰期进行备份等

     3.备份数据的安全与隐私 备份数据同样需要严格的安全管理,防止数据泄露

    除了加密处理外,还应实施访问控制策略,限制对备份数据的访问权限,并定期进行安全审计

     五、结语 数据库所有表备份是维护数据安全、保障业务连续性的基石

    面对日益复杂的数据环境和不断演变的威胁态势,企业必须构建一套全面、高效、灵活的备份体系

    这要求企业从制定科学的备份计划、选择合适的备份工具、实施自动化备份、加强加密与压缩等方面入手,同时注重异地备份、定期测试恢复流程、文档化与培训以及监控与报警等最佳实践的应用

    面对数据量激增、备份窗口有限以及备份数据的安全与隐私等挑战,企业应积极探索新技术、新方法,不断优化备份策略,确保在任何情况下都能迅速、准确地恢复数据,为企业的稳健发展提供坚实保障

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道